Php get_plugins()在执行delete_plugins()后不是给出插件列表

Php get_plugins()在执行delete_plugins()后不是给出插件列表,php,wordpress,Php,Wordpress,执行delete_plugins()操作后,get_plugins()将给出已删除的插件列表 例如: delete_plugins(array('akismet/akismet.php')); get_plugins(); 我做错什么了吗?任何人都可以对此给出一些见解。这个问题已经解决了。这是选择的解决方案- 激活的插件存储在WordPress的选项表中 关键活跃插件下的博客 因此,您可以使用get_选项(“活动_插件”);对每个博客进行分析和比较 阵列 我又添加了一行以清除缓存,它现在正在工

执行delete_plugins()操作后,get_plugins()将给出已删除的插件列表

例如:

delete_plugins(array('akismet/akismet.php'));
get_plugins();
我做错什么了吗?任何人都可以对此给出一些见解。

这个问题已经解决了。这是选择的解决方案-

激活的插件存储在WordPress的选项表中 关键活跃插件下的博客

因此,您可以使用get_选项(“活动_插件”);对每个博客进行分析和比较 阵列


我又添加了一行以清除缓存,它现在正在工作

delete_plugins( array( 'akismet/akismet.php' ) );
wp_clean_plugins_cache( false );
get_plugins();

如果删除的插件处于非活动插件状态,我们将怎么做?